Tips for the Living Room
Living rooms that are prone to disorganization can benefit significantly from enhanced storage solutions designed to accommodate a variety of items. Options such as built-in shelving, cabinets, tall bookcases, entertainment centers, and furniture with integrated storage—like ottomans, coffee tables with drawers, storage benches, and baskets—can promote effective organization.
Decorative baskets serve as practical containers for books, pillows, blankets, or toys, while certain coffee tables offer additional storage via baskets, shelves, drawers, or lift-up compartments. Ottomans not only provide supplementary seating but may also feature removable trays and lift-top sections to increase storage capacity. Console tables equipped with shelves and drawers create display and storage opportunities behind sofas or in entryways, effectively accommodating items such as keys, wallets, and purses.
Vertical storage is achievable through built-in shelving, tall bookcases, floating shelves, and ladder shelves, all suitable for organizing books, decorative objects, blankets, or larger items. These solutions enable both the display and containment of smaller possessions. Ladder shelves, in particular, can support plants, books, or storage baskets, thereby enhancing spatial functionality.
A compact entertainment center offers centralized storage for electronics, board games, plants, and decorative pieces. Freestanding cabinets or hutches further expand storage potential for blankets, books, games, and toys. Glass-front hutches or curio cabinets allow for orderly item display, while traditional hutches assist in maintaining organization ahead of guest visits. When selecting furniture, it is advisable to consider options featuring concealed storage.
